    I would've preferred titan runestones having a more static rate of acquisition, even if it was 1 or 2 a week you'd at least know what to expect.

    Also, if you look at the primary collection mechanism for each legendary thus far:

    - Stats gem: RNG (Dual RNG stream, reasonably forgiving if you do the content weekly)
    - Prismatic Socket: Static (could choose to do it at your own pace)
    - Meta gem: RNG (similar droprate as runestones but much larger pool of bosses to loot from)
    - Cloak: RNG

    I would've preferred an RNG-Static-RNG-Static-RNG-... approach, so you'd at least not follow up an RNG collection quest with another RNG collection quest like we have now...

    I hope Siege of Org's legendary quests spice it up a bit and get a bit more involved in the process of boss kills and raiding, similar to how ICC made you do the bosses differently for your shadowmourne collectors.

    Yeah well it's sucky but that's how it is with all these "farm up a bunch of fragments" style legendary quest chains. I do agree about the RNG, it's just shitty. The clusters in DS were a better system - they took a long time but at least you were guaranteed to get them in 25m (and your drop chance was high in 10m) so you at least wouldn't feel like a whole week was wasted.

    WoW has a core philosophy that RNG can be fun, but it rarely is. I'd personally like to see it de-emphasise RNG elements but I can't see the dev team really moving strongly in that direction at the moment.

    Quote Originally Posted by ramennoodleking View Post
    You would have loved it in Vanilla when you were lucky to even see a fragment of a legendary drop.

    tl;dr Not everything is handed out on a silver platter
    There was only one legendary pre-Wrath with fragments, A'tiesh, and how many people even did old Naxx? Meanwhile every other legendary until Ulduar just plopped out of the boss (or the mats that crafted it did, ie Eye of Sulfuras, Bindings). If you were lucky you could get the Eye on your first ever run. Or have the bow in Sunwell just drop into your hands. Or if you were unlucky you could spend two years clearing MC every week until you got your second Binding.

    I wish people would stop pretending some things were "hard" or you "earned" them when they were simply determined by RNG.
